Bursaspor sack manager Paul Le Guen

Bursaspor board unilaterally parted ways with 54-year-old Frenchman Paul Le Guen today, after sub-par performances throughout the season.

Turkish Super Lig team Bursaspor sacked manager Paul Le Guen on Tuesday after the team’s poor performance in recent weeks. The former Rangers manager was hired last summer however his time has been cut short – he lasted just nine months.

The team said talks with Le Guen to reach a mutual agreement to terminate his contract failed, leaving the club with no other option than to sack the 54-year-old Frenchman.

Assistant manager Mustafa Er is expected to take over for the remaining six matches.

On Sunday, Bursaspor lost to Kasimpasa 1-0 at home which was the final nail in the coffin for Le Guen. The Green Crocodiles have lost 7 of their last 11 matches.

It has been reported that Le Guen has received €1,725,000 in compensation for the termination of his contract.
